vue中如何调用iframe的方法传值和iframe如何给vue传值

iframe给Vue页面传值

第一步:需要在iframe的index.html  的js  加入下面代码

 







PHPWord


                    


Title

 

 

编号

主要工程内容

本月完成量

自开工至本月底累计完成工程量

合同工程量

开通至今完成合同工程量占比

备注

**1**

##AA检测##

**2**

##BB检测##

 

 

在div里面点击tableClick  就可以给vue通信

在vue页面中需要进入监听就可以传值并且触发vue的方法:mounted() {

window.addEventListener('message', function(e){
  console.log(e)
这个里面也可以调用vue的方法
})

}

在vue页面中需要需要触发iframe的方法只需要下面的代码

this.$refs.iframe.contentWindow.addText(this.gct,this.tabcon)

就可以触发iframe的index.html里面的addText方法

 

 

 

你可能感兴趣的:(vue中如何调用iframe的方法传值和iframe如何给vue传值)